MTR Foods - Management Trainee - International Business(IIFT) - Young Professional Development Program


We're looking for bright young MBA Graduates from IB specialization who are interested in building a career in the FMCG industry to join our Young Professionals Development Batch 2022 and be part of the MTR growth story.

YPDP 2022 : Snapshot

Program Architecture: Young Professionals Development Program (YPDP) 2022 program is a 1-year program broadly divided into 3 phases:

- Induction and Orientation (2 Weeks).

- Cross-Functional Exposure Training. Work on live implementable projects across functions regardless of your core area of specialization (28 Weeks).

- Posting as IB Manager

Location : During the YPDP Cross-Functional Exposure Training: Bangalore/Kochi/Anywhere in India

Final Location as IB Manager : Anywhere in India

Compensation : Rs. 15.40 Lakhs CTC (11.30 Lakhs Fixed + 1.70 Lakhs Performance Linked Variable Pay(annual) + 2.00 Lakhs retention bonus).

Eligibility Criteria :

- Full Time 2 years MBA/PGDM from IIFT (Delhi/Kolkata)

- 2022 Pass out Batch

Responsibility and mandate : IB Manager

- Formulate and Execute Advertising and Promotion schemes in collaboration with the Marketing Function.

- Collaborate with Manufacturing and Supply Chain for development of export specific products, production and deliveries.

- Build positive and impacting relationship with all channel partners within the framework of company policies.

- Implement and administer policies, plans, systems and targets in respect of local key accounts.

- Collaborate with HR to source, select and develop a talent pool including export markets. Coach and counsel for development, retention and succession.

Main challenges in this position :

- Develop volume, value, margin, product and geography strategy for export business.

- Develop and update Export Sales Operation Manual outlining the interplay and roles of various channel partners and managers, export sales systems, documentation, distributor policies, stock norms, application of credit and discounts, billing, collections and risk management.

- Developing and implementing sales strategies for increase of market share and profitability on sustainable basis in line with Annual Business Plan.

- Execute annual plans for the MTR Product range including value, volume and margin targets.

Selection Process :

- Stage 1 - Profile Shortlisting

- Stage 2 - Personal Interview: Round 1

- Stage 3 - Personal Interview: Round 2
